Product Overview

The LKS1D5003D is a high-voltage single-phase IPM (Intelligent Power Module) integrating a high-voltage IC and high-performance MOSFETs, suitable for Brushless DC (BLDC) and Permanent Magnet Synchronous (PMSM) motors. The source of the low-side MOSFET can be used for current sampling. The input includes a Schmitt trigger and is compatible with 3.3V/5V/15V logic levels. The LKS1D5003D utilizes an ESOP13 package.

Technical Specifications

ParameterConditionMinTypicalMaxUnitNotes
Inverter Section
MOSFET Drain-Source Voltage (BVDSS)VIN = 0 V, ID = 250 uA500V
MOSFET Cut-off Drain Current (IDSS)VIN = 0 V, VDS = 500 V1uA
Body Diode Forward On-Voltage (VSD)VCC = VBS = 15V, VIN = 0 V, ID = -3 A1.4V
MOSFET On-Resistance (RDS(ON))VCC = VBS = 15 V, VIN = 5 V, ID =0.5A3.3ohm
Switching Time (TON)VPN =400 V, VCC = VBS = 15 V, ID = 3A, VIN = 0~5 V, Inductive Load L = 2.8 mH560nsHigh-side and low-side MOSFETs
Switching Time (TOFF)VPN =400 V, VCC = VBS = 15 V, ID = 3A, VIN = 0~5 V, Inductive Load L = 2.8 mH205nsHigh-side and low-side MOSFETs
Energy (EON)VPN =400 V, VCC = VBS = 15 V, ID = 3A, VIN = 0~5 V, Inductive Load L = 2.8 mH85uJ
Energy (EOFF)VPN =400 V, VCC = VBS = 15 V, ID = 3A, VIN = 0~5 V, Inductive Load L = 2.8 mH8uJ
Control Section
Static VCC Supply Current (IQCC)VCC = 15V, VIN = 0V50uA
Static VBS Supply Current (IQB)VBS = 15V, VIN = 0V35uA
Undervoltage Protection VCC On (VCC_ON)8.5VRising edge
Undervoltage Protection VBS On (VBS_ON)8.7VRising edge
Undervoltage Protection VCC Off (VCC_UVLO)7.6VFalling edge
Undervoltage Protection VBS Off (VBS_UVLO)7.8VFalling edge
Voltage Hysteresis VCC (VCC_HYS)0.9V
Voltage Hysteresis VBS (VBS_HYS)0.9V
Logic High Threshold (VIH)2.4V
Logic Low Threshold (VIL)0.6V
Bootstrap Diode
Forward Voltage (VFB)IF = 0.8A1.65V
Reverse Recovery Time (TRRB)IF = 0.5A40ns
Recommended Operating Conditions
Power Supply Voltage (VPN)Between P and N pins300400V
Control Supply Voltage (VCC)Between VCC and COM pins12.015.018.0V
High-side Bias Voltage (VBS)Between VB and VS pins12.015.018.0V
Input Turn-on Voltage (VIN(ON))Between VIN and COM pins3.0VCCV
Input Turn-off Voltage (VIN(OFF))Between VIN and COM pins00.4V
Dead Time (TDEAD)VCC = VBS = 12.0 ~ 18.0V, TJ <150C1.0usInternal logic typical dead time 100ns
PWM Switching Frequency (FPWM)TJ <150C20KHz
